The Concept of Balance Bikes
Balance bikes are essentially two-wheeled cycles that lack pedals. Designed primarily for children aged 18 months to 5 years, these bikes focus on teaching balance, coordination, and steering. The absence of pedals allows children to use their feet to propel themselves forward, making it easier to learn how to balance without the fear of falling. This design addresses a fundamental challenge that most young cyclists face learning to balance on two wheels.

Transitioning to Pedal Bikes
One of the most exciting milestones in a child’s cycling journey is the transition from a balance bike to a pedal bike. Many parents find that children who have spent time on balance bikes adapt more quickly to pedal bikes. This is because they have already mastered the crucial balance component, allowing them to focus on the pedaling motion with greater ease. The transition becomes more of a natural progression rather than a daunting challenge.
